Cooling down with Swedes and making a splash with Norwegians

Posted by: Carmel , 19 juni, 2013

We are currently experiencing a mini-heatwave in the Netherlands (it won’t last, probably by the time this article gets posted it will be a long lost memory). Right now though, it is hot! And as I ponder some watery ways to cool down, my mind wanders to our latest luistertip on our own Nordic Vibes website.

shoutoutlouds_blueice

If you recall (see here for a quick recap), it features the latest album from Sweden’s Shout Out Louds, Optica. One of the tracks on the album is called ‘Blue Ice’. (Ice is cool… yes, thinking of ice is helping, I’m cooling down already.) A little while back, this song was issued as the first single from the album as an extremely limited release – a 7″ record made of ice! Yes, you heard right. And if you want to see – and hear – more about what a record made of ice sounds like, check out this video:

Yes! Feeling cooler already.

What else might help? Playing about with some water maybe? If you recall the magnificent plunging-into-a-pool photo of fellow Swedes This Is Head a few weeks back in another luistertip (see here), you might also recall the song ‘Time’s an Ocean’ which features the question ‘Are you swimming/are you floating?’ Having a splash around would bring the temperature down a bit.

And the last suggestion? Why, jumping into the water fully clothed is the only thing! This is where the Norwegians make a splash – a beautiful song by Jonas Alaska, ‘If Only As A Ghost’, will bring the tempo down a bit as well as the temperature (filmed by André Chocron).

Jonas Alaska – If Only As A Ghost from André Chocron // Frokost Film on Vimeo.
